Initial design development is often the foundation of a successful engineering project. It involves developing an initial idea into a practical design concept that considers functionality, appearance, performance, production requirements, and practical application. Skilled designers communicate directly with project teams to understand their objectives and develop concepts that can move efficiently into engineering and production. A carefully developed concept can reduce design complications and create a reliable starting point for the entire development process.

Class-A surface modeling is another important service for industries that require exceptionally detailed product surfaces. It focuses on creating high-quality surfaces with accuracy and consistency that meet demanding design standards. In automotive, railway, and marine industries, exterior and interior surfaces can have a major impact on visual quality and practical performance. Advanced surfacing techniques help designers achieve refined forms while maintaining the required relationships between different components.

CAD-based engineering services provides the technical foundation needed to turn design concepts into detailed engineering models. Computer-aided design allows professionals to create accurate three-dimensional models, assemblies, technical drawings, and production-ready engineering data. CAD-based engineering can also help identify design-related challenges before manufacturing begins. This approach improves communication between designers, engineers, manufacturers, and other project stakeholders while supporting greater consistency throughout the development cycle.

Interior and exterior design services are particularly valuable in transportation-related industries. Automotive vehicles, rail transit systems, and ships require carefully developed interiors that balance comfort, usability, safety, durability, and visual appeal. Exterior design, meanwhile, must consider aerodynamics, structural requirements, environmental conditions, manufacturing limitations, and overall appearance. A professional service provider can combine creative design thinking with engineering knowledge to develop solutions that satisfy both design and performance objectives.

Welding cells are widely used in industrial manufacturing environments where different parts must be assembled with precision and repeatability. A properly designed welding cell can optimize workflow while supporting repeatable production. Welding fixtures are another essential element of modern manufacturing. They help position and hold components securely during welding, reducing movement and improving assembly consistency. Well-engineered fixtures can contribute to consistent production quality while making repetitive manufacturing operations more efficient. Their design requires an understanding of part geometry, welding methods, accessibility requirements, dimensional tolerances, and manufacturing environments.

Industrial robot integration solutions can further enhance manufacturing capabilities. Robotic systems can perform repeated welding, assembly, and material-handling operations with a high level of consistency. Professional integration services can include automation planning, equipment coordination, programming support, fixture integration, and production workflow optimization. When properly implemented, robotic integration can help manufacturers improve productivity while maintaining reliable process control.
